Daniel Ricciardo’s home race in Melbourne last weekend wasn’t all sunshine and celebrations, but the Aussie is turning his disappointment into something positive for children in need.
Ricciardo’s eye-catching Australian Grand Prix helmet is now up for grabs through a special online auction, with all proceeds going to a worthy cause.
The design of Danny Ric’s unique lid was the brainchild of 20-year-old Australian artist Rosie Pettenon, whose creation won a competition hosted by Optus.
The original creative brief called for artists to capture the essence of "identifiably Australian optimism."
Rosie Pettenon incorporated Australian gums, wattle and Kangaroo paw, the floral emblem of Daniel’s home state of Western Australian within the design.
Hidden symbols such as the Honey Badger, Daniel’s racing persona, and kangaroos were integrated to represent Daniel’s family.
“I am so blown away to be a part of such a cool project. I knew it was an amazing opportunity and having my design chosen was a dream come true,” said Rosie.
“I was super flattered that Daniel was keen on keeping the design true to my own art practise, one that I am so passionate about sharing.”
“During my career I've worn plenty of helmet designs, all crafted by talented artists, and most with a meaningful message, but it's the first time I've given a chance for a member of the public to design it,” commented Ricciardo.
“My helmet has always been that creative outlet, it's really the only canvas we have, especially in a sport so driven by numbers and analytics.
“Being able to collaborate with emerging Australian artist, Rosie, and with Optus providing this platform to showcase her design talent, it's really put a huge smile on my face.”
The incredible piece of racing memorabilia is more than just a helmet; it's a chance to own a piece of Australian F1 history and support a great cause.
The auction, which benefits Save the Children Australia, a charity Ricciardo is passionately involved with, is already heating up.
With three days left to bid, the unreserved most recent offer currently sits at a hefty $51,000.
